Couple of weeks after I got the Bronco home (June 1-2), the battery light came on and I got a charging system fault on FP. Had the local dealer look into it and everything checked out, but kept throwing the code. They had it a week and had Ford engineers give them a few things to test that came up empty. They sent the Bronco home with me while they waited on more ideas from Ford. Two weeks ago I took it back in and they have run multitudes of tests, all coming back ok. They thought they had it figured out with a bad BCM and just finished that instal this morning. Fault code still there! Waiting on more ideas from the engineers next week now. Next Thursday will be 4 weeks it's been in the shop since June.
Not blaming the local guys here in Ames. They seem to have tried everything and now it's on the engineers at Ford. Weird thing is you'd never know there's a problem. Everything runs fine. Battery stays charged. Alt is charging properly. All the electronics work fine.

Anyone else out there had this happen?

You need part # MU5Z-14526-AZA it is on the positive side of battery with 10 amp fuse , it fixed my Bronco.

Yes it happened to me found out the top positive terminal has a 3amp fuse that is not seating that controls only the dash light ,replace the part# MU5Z-14626- AZA

What does Auto S/S have to do with the battery code??
Not sure this is what they're alluding to but, I disconnected the little red device that's attached to the battery when I was told it would turn the auto stop off permanently. Problem is disconnecting that threw a charging system error. I figured it was just meritless warning but wasn't willing to risk it so I reconnected. Perhaps the charging system warning just doesn't like the auto stop being disabled.
